Folk Nylon Ball End
"Wound strings consist of a wrap wire coiled around a core of nylon floss (hundreds of tiny strands). Silver plated copper is the most popular. 80/20 bronze follows close behind.
Plain strings are made of a solid nylon filament. It is similar to, but not the same as, the nylon used for fishing line. They come in clear, black, and sometimes yellow "gold" color."
